The local prison administration in Kenitra denies allegations regarding the conditions of inmates.

The General Delegation for Prison Administration and Reintegration, through the administration of the local prison in Kenitra, has denied claims circulating on Facebook regarding what was described as the “suffering of inmates” within the correctional facility, emphasizing that such allegations do not reflect reality.

The prison administration stated in a clarifying statement directed at the public that the concerns raised about “the spread of itch disease and lack of hygiene and healthcare conditions” are unfounded, underscoring that inmates showing any health symptoms are promptly attended to, with necessary medications and warm water for bathing provided. The statement also highlighted that cleaning operations are conducted daily, and hygiene materials are regularly distributed to all inmates, including newcomers.

Regarding the claims related to long wait times and mistreatment during family visits, the administration confirmed that these allegations are false, explaining that visits are organized through an approved “visitation platform.”

The statement further noted that some visit denials are attributed to certain visitors not adhering to the designated schedules via the platform or insisting on visiting outside the scheduled times, prompting the administration to enforce applicable legal regulations.

In conclusion, the Kenitra local prison administration reiterated its commitment to respecting the rights of inmates and ensuring housing conditions that align with existing laws and regulations, while also committing to communicate with the public to correct any misinformation that may arise.
